What we eat every day plays a meaningful role in long-term brain health.
Research increasingly links ultra-processed foods, excessive sugar spikes, artificial sweeteners, and alcohol to inflammation, metabolic disruption, and cognitive decline. The encouraging news: simple substitutions—such as choosing whole foods, minimizing processing, and prioritizing nutrient-dense options—can support brain function over time.
